Clare man assaulted, Keyes charged
By Pat Maurer
Review Correspondent
Clare Police Chief Brian Gregory is asking for witnesses to a March 3rd assault to call them.
The incident, an aggravated Assault is the early morning in Gateway Lanes’ parking lot, reportedly began with an argument between two Clare men. It “became physical,” said Gregory, and the 29-year old victim was “knocked unconscious” with a “serious head injury.”
The victim was taken to MidMichigan Medical Center – Clare and transferred to MidMichigan Medical Center – Midland where he underwent surgery. He was in the critical care unit in the Midland hospital on Monday.
The 27-year old suspect, Keenon Keyes, was arrested on charges of Aggravated Assault and arraigned in 80th District Court Monday on one count of Assault and one count of Assault with Intent to do Great Bodily Harm. His bond was set at $100,000/10 percent cash surety. He posted bond and was released Monday.
The incident is still under investigation, Gregory said, and anyone who may have seen the incident is asked to contact Detective Greg Kolhoff at the Clare Police Department. The number is 989-386-2121.
